General description

HEPES buffer does not confer cytotoxic effects on cells and thus can be used in animal cell cultures.
HEPES has been described as one of the best all-purpose buffers available for biological research. At biological pH, the molecule is zwitterionic, and is effective as a buffer at pH 6.8 to 8.2. HEPES has been used in a wide variety of applications, including tissue culture. It is commonly used to buffer cell culture media in air. HEPES finds its usage in in vitro experiments on Mg.

Application

HEPES has been used:
  • To supplement Dulbecco′s modified Eagle′s medium to culture and maintain cell lines
  • As a component of platelet suspension buffer
  • To supplement Hank′s basic salt solution, which is used to wash pancreatic tissue
  • As a component of wash buffer and blocking buffer in the purification and quantification of protein with enzyme-linked immunosorbent (ELISA) assay
  • For the adjustment and maintenance of pH of biological solutions
  • As a component of Hank′s balanced salt solution (HBSS) and dissociation medium to study neuronal development
  • For homogenization of tissue and in the preparation of cytosolic and nuclear extract from cells
  • As a component of keratinocyte and fibroblast culture medium
